AHMAD, NAFIS The Indo-Pakistan Boundary Disputes Tribunal, 1949-1950. From Geographical Review Vol 43, No 3, 1953, pp 329-337
New York, American Geographical Society of New York. 1953. Offprint. 9pp, 4 maps. Tall 8vo/25.5cm. Printed grey wrappers, light soil and wear, internally fine. On the details of four disputes mediated by the Boundary Disputes Tribunal during 1949-50. All had to do with East Bengal. The paper was read at the Seventeenth Internation Geographical Congress held at Washington D.C. in August 1952. Nafis Ahmad was Reader in Geography and Head of the Geography Department at the University of Dacca, East Pakistan.
